Tae Kwon Do Master - Ali Roshankish 4th Dan
Master Ali Roshankish’s life has been directed by the practice of the martial arts. Growing up in Iran he first started training in traditional Shotokan Karate, gaining a black belt in this system. As a teenager he came to the U.S. speaking little English and lacking any sense of belonging or any real direction to his life. Through the values of hard-work and discipline that his original martial arts training gave him he started to firmly take hold of the opportunities that his new country gave him. He worked hard in his studies and started to train in his first Korean Martial Art, that of Tang Soo Do, going on to gain a 2nd Degree Black Belt in this system. It was around this time that he knew he wanted to teach others and communicate the values that traditional martial arts training had given him and that had helped him so much in his own life. Whilst training in Tang Soo Do, he started to also train in Tae Kwon Do and eventually went on to gain his first black belt in this system.
In 1997 he opened his first school and began training his very first students (many of whom are still training). Although it was making no money and he had to hold down three jobs to keep it going he persevered knowing that to follow a dream is not easy but that hard work and perseverance are necessary if you want to achieve your goals (Students of Master Roshankish know that “dreams” are something you hope happens but that goals are something you aim and work towards).
Bit by bit, his school grew and he was forced to move locations twice to accommodate the ever increasing number of students wanting traditional martial arts training – something that is unfortunately becoming all too rare in today’s society. In 2000 he moved the school to its current location in Medford, Massachusetts, where it has become a notable part of the Medford and Somerville community.
Tae Kwon Do Instructor - Vinny Araujo 2nd Dan
Vinny Araujo is a 2nd Degree Black Belt. He has been training under Master Roshankish for 8 years and is director of the children’s Tae Kwon Do program at Roshankish Tae Kwon Do. He is a former Tae Kwon Do Junior Olympic Champion winning a silver medal in 2004 and has taken one of his students to win Silver at the 2009 Junior Olympics that were held in Texas. He is also a Level 1 SEPS Children’s Self Defense & School Bullying instructor.
As well as heading the children’s Tae Kwon Do program he also assists in the teaching of the adult program.
